Ikorodu Bois have dropped another thrilling imitation of the video of Wizkid’s 'Essence', which featured 'Tems'.
With “Essence” being a global hit and song of the summer, the Ikorodu Bois jumped on the opportunity to recreate and deliver an adaption of the song in the best way they know how to.
“Essence” is the 11th track on Wizkid's “Made In Lagos” album.
Taking to Twitter to share the video adaption, Ikodrodu Bois wrote, “can’t make this slide without jumping on it! Song of the summer!!! #ikoroduboisversion #essence #wizkid #Tems #lowbudget small wiz X Big Wiz!! @wizkidayo.”

The Ikorodu Bois shot to the limelight after mimicking a rehearsal session of Cuppy.
They were nominated in the Favourite African Social Media Star category for the 2021 Nickelodeon’s Kids Choice Awards alongside Elsa Majimbo, Bonang, Emmanuella, Ghetto Kids and Wian Van Den Berg.
